What is the Glance in MI?

Let’s discuss a little more, Xiaomi has two kinds of lock screen/main screen. First is the regular lock screen, which appears when you press the power button.

This plain lock screen contains wallpapers that you set yourself and some simple widgets like a clock and calendar.

While glance is a lock screen whose wallpaper changes automatically when you’re connected to the internet.

Glance also has a general widget, but at glance, we can get certain information from the internet (usually news).

#3. Through MTK Engineering

Through MTK Engineering

Especially for phones with Mediatek chipset. The MTK Engineering method is the most widely used method to restore an invalid IMEI.

The steps are as follows:

  1. Open MTK Engineering mode. To do this, open Phone > then dial *#*#3646633#*#*.
  2. If you have entered MTK Engineering, select Connectivity.
  3. Next, select CDS Information.
  4. Then, select Radio Information.
  5. Then select SIM 1 or Phone 1, then AT+ will appear.
  6. Enter IMEI like this: AT+EMGR=1.7, “Enter your IMEI here”.
  7. If so, click Send AT Command.
  8. Repeat the steps again in the same way on SIM 2 or Phone 2.

Through MTK Engineering

Please note, maybe in some types of phones, sometimes there are slight differences in the steps in the tutorial above.

But the point remains the same, namely entering the IMEI via MTK Engineering.

Causes of Application Not Installed Error on Android

#1. Not Enough Memory:

We have to make sure that the cellphone still has enough storage capacity. Otherwise, the application will not be able to be installed.

In the Playstore, there is usually an additional ” insufficient storage space ” message.

#2. Installation Error:

Common on rooted phones. The application should be installed in a certain directory, but this is not. The effect will appear a message like ” incorrect Apk install location “.

#3. System Error:

The Android system may have an error. Especially when the phone is used for certain needs. The impact can vary, and some of them can cause errors in the application installation process.

#4. Unsupported Applications:

Both in terms of versions and systems that are not supported. This can happen sometimes.

For example, I installed an application that only supports up to Android Jelly Bean on Android Oreo. Usually, a “not compatible” message will appear.

#7. Clear the Cache of the Snapchat App on Your Android Mobile

Clear the Cache of the Snapchat App on Your Android Mobile

When you use a filter, send a message, make a publication or watch someone else’s Snap, the application saves all that information in the cache of your mobile.

If for any reason an error appears when performing any of the actions mentioned above, the application will save that error in the cache, so that error could be repeated “infinitely” .

This will cause the application to stop working constantly, so in that case, the only solution that can be carried out to eradicate the problem is to delete the cache of the Snapchat application on Android.

Not sure how to clear the cache? Follow these steps that we leave you below:

  1. Enter the Settings of your Android mobile device.
  2. Enter the section that says “Applications and notifications.”
  3. Click on the Snapchat application.
  4. Enter the section that says “Storage and Cache.”
  5. And finally, click on «Clear cache memory».

With the Snapchat cache removed, you will have to open the app to check if the problem has been fixed.

Causes of Unfortunately Android.Process.Media Has Stopped

Android Process Media is part of Download Manager as well as File Manager. Function to run the two applications.

When the message stops appearing on Android Process Media, it’s likely a bug or a full cellphone memory.

All Android phones are at risk of experiencing this problem. Samsung, Xiaomi, OPPO, Vivo, Lenovo, ASUS, and others.

Causes of Phone Screen Vertical or Horizontal Stripes

Causes of Phone Screen Vertical or Horizontal Stripes

There are several causes that can make the Stripes on Phone Screen, whether it’s in a vertical or horizontal form.

Some of them are as follows:

1. Due to Fall

When the cellphone is dropped, one of the consequences can affect the touchscreen. For example, making the screen blank or even no image appears at all.

So even with the striped screen, which is characterized by the presence of a permanent line (cannot be lost).

2. Stuff Pressed Screen

The phone screen is pressed by a heavy object, this can damage the screen too, of course, including causing streaks on the LCD.

However, usually, this is not permanent. When the screen is pressed again the phone can return to normal.

3. Screen Connector Problem

When displaying an image on the screen, the phone needs a connector component to connect the mainboard to the LCD.

If the connector has a problem, loose for example, this can bring up lines on the cellphone screen.

4. Phone Gets Water

Most phones now do not fully support waterproofing. Even if there are, usually still have certain limitations.

Well, if the cellphone is exposed to water, this can be very risky to damage the screen. For example the colorful lines on the LCD.

5. System Error

Relatively rare, but it can happen. Maybe because of root effect, unstable system, or other reasons.

Those are five factors that are thought to be at risk of being the cause. Then, how to deal with it?

What is the IMEI Number?

According to the definition in English, IMEI is the International Mobile Equipment Identity, that is, the identification that the manufacturer assigns to the mobile.

The code is useful for technical service tasks, changing phone companies, for reasons related to the warranty, tracking the cell phone by IMEI Tracker, and to block the phone in case of theft or loss.

Why is the IMEI Address so Important?

The IMEI address of your Android smartphone is also related to the security of the device.

In the event that the device is stolen, you must report the fact and provide the number so that the authorities and the operator can block it and carry out the respective follow-up.

It is also important to know the IMEI number of the device to be able to reset it, in case it had been erased when updating a custom ROM (Operating System File) file or something related.
